A luvetric pulse was a type of wide-area blast a personnel phaser could be modified to emit.

In 2369, the crew of USS Enterprise-D were looking for Data and Crosis, a Borg drone, on a planet with naturally high EM interference in its magnetosphere. They had a 20 kilometer radius search zone and the interference made it impossible to use sensors to locate Data.

Captain Jean-Luc Picard suggested they could modify a phaser to send out a luvetric pulse. Such a pulse would have created a resonance fluctuation in Data's power cells. They could have then pinpointed the fluctuation with a tricorder. Geordi La Forge then pointed out that to be effective the pulse would have to be so powerful that it would destroy Data's positronic net in the process. (TNG: "Descent")
